Web6 Mar 2024 · Purpose Counts the number of rows in a table which meet a set of conditions. Syntax. CountIf(source, condition1 [, condition2, …]) Arguments. source – a table of values to count. condition – a logical expression evaluated for each row of the table that decides which rows to count. In the app below depending on which button I click I can force the cursor to go ... Web22 Nov 2024 · timeout: Optional. It specifies the period of time to wait before the notification message is automatically deleted. The time is expressed as a number of milliseconds. The timer is set to 10 seconds or 10,000 milliseconds by default. The message will be removed from the Powerapps screen after 10 seconds.
